Thousands March in Cabo Rojo Against Esencia Megaproject, Answering Bad Bunny's On-Screen Call
Hours after Bad Bunny's Aug. 22 closing-night message flashed "ESENCIA NO VA. MAÑANA 2:00 PM. MARCHA CABO ROJO" across the Hiram Bithorn stadium screens — triggering a stadium-wide chant of "¡Esencia no va!" — the Coalición Defiende a Cabo Rojo (DaCR) led a national march and public hearing dubbed "Cabo Rojo es nuestro – Marcha a la vista" on Aug. 23. Hundreds of demonstrators, including planners, scientists, and educators, gathered at the intersection of Highways 100 and 308, marching with Puerto Rican flags and arriving by bicycle and tractor, stopping periodically along the route to discuss the roughly $2 billion Proyecto Esencia luxury resort's threats to housing access, ecological reserves, and the region's water supply, before concluding at the Dr. Ramón Emeterio Betances public plaza. Opposition organizers argued the project's siting was approved "a espaldas del pueblo y sin vistas públicas" (behind the public's back, without public hearings) and would benefit only a handful of investors. It was DaCR's second major mobilization against Esencia after a March 28, 2026 march in Old San Juan, but the first amplified directly from Bad Bunny's own stage.
